The Autism Society of America proudly celebrates Founder’s Day on November 14th. We would like to take a moment to reflect on the Autism Society’s rich history and honor the legacy that Ruth C. Sullivan, Bernard Rimland, and Ole Ivar Lovass created when forming this organization in 1965.


“This Founder’s Day, the Autism Society reflects our long history and honors the collective role we all play in ensuring that Autistic individuals and their loved ones can connect with each other, with resources, and with supports and services so that they may live full, vibrant, self-actualized lives.” - Christopher Banks, President and CEO of the Autism Society of America


The Autism Society strives to learn and evolve by expanding services, opportunities, programs, and support to better serve the Autism community. We’ve seen significant impact including the growth of our National Helpline and Vaccine Education Initiative. Our National Programs team also recently expanded as we introduced our Employment Initiative, “Safety on Spectrum” First Responders Training and Water and Wandering Programs. 


Throughout the organization’s evolution, our mission is to create connections, empowering everyone in the Autism community to live fully.
